Mark Capri, a talented individual, embarked on his professional journey after completing his training at the prestigious Royal Academy of Dramatic Art. He began his career in the UK, where he had the privilege of working with the renowned Royal Shakespeare Company and various theatres across England.
His extensive travels took him to India and Southeast Asia, where he honed his craft and gained valuable experience. During this time, he also appeared in numerous British television spots, as well as the iconic film Star Wars: Episode V - The Empire Strikes Back, released in 1980.
Capri's impressive resume continued to grow as he transitioned to New York, where he made his stage debut in the Roundabout Theatre's production of "On Approval." This outstanding performance earned him a Theatre World Award, a testament to his exceptional talent.
Throughout his illustrious career, Mark Capri has appeared in over a hundred plays, effortlessly transitioning between leading roles on stage and occasional film and television appearances. His impressive repertoire spans the regional theater system, touring productions, and, more recently, his current residence in Los Angeles.
